Tuesday's Top (Five) - Top E-Tail Trends

Following a full analysis of over 200 of their online stores, CSN has released its Top 5 E-Retail Trends for Tackling Tough Times. The list includes everything from mood-elevating, yellow accents to fight the recession blues, to ergonomic and modern home office furniture. Here are the Top Five Trends:

5: More Telecommuting = More Home Offices. Some employment experts say nearly 50 percent of companies are looking at telecommuting options for 2009. In response, sales of desk accessories at CSNOfficeFurniture.com have increased by more than 20 percent; while sales of ergonomic accessories, office organizers and storage accents all went up by around 100 percent.

4: Spring Greening with Eco-Friendly Finds. Meeting the demand for ‘green’ and ‘eco-friendly’ ideas, CSN recently added hundreds of innovative eco-friendly finds to their online stores. From toilet seats to trash compactors, these new products prove that ‘greening’ your home can be easy and affordable.

3: Staying Mellow with a Yellow Twist. The color industry’s trend-setter, Pantone, declared yellow the new “in” color for 2009 and plenty of décor mavens, industry influencers and furniture manufacturers have embraced the trend. In response, CSN developed its ‘Say Yes to Yellow’ list of inspiring items designed to brighten up any room or mood.

2: Tattoo Your walls with Tapestries and Art. Mood-elevating tapestries and 3D art now make up 50% of the sales at CSN site TheWallArtStore.com, a significant increase from last year. These items offer consumers an affordable way to elevate the atmosphere in any room, without the hassle of a complete room makeover.

1: Do-It-Yourself Makeover. In response to the rising costs of materials and labor, CSN has seen the DIY category expand. Recently, they added over 60,000 new tools to their site, CSNSupply.com, to meet the high demands of DIY consumers.

CSN Mondays: CSN and our DIY Nation

Recently, CNBC and other news sources have reported on the increased significance of a DIY lifestyle during tough economic times. Reports suggest that, instead of hiring professionals, more and more homeowners are tackling indoor and outdoor chores, redecorating/remodeling projects, and minor household repairs in order to save in ’09. Some have gone so far as to say that, due to the popularity of this trend and the extent of the recession, the U.S. is growing into a ‘DIY Nation.’

For CSN Mondays, I wanted to spotlight a few initiatives CSN Stores, a top three online retailer, has recently launched in response to the DIY surge.
